About the role

The adjunct faculty member will teach courses in American Sign Language and/or Deaf Culture to students within the Department of Literature and Language. Responsibilities include delivering high-quality instruction in a post-secondary setting on a semester-by-semester basis.

Job Summary The Department of Literature and Language at East Tennessee State University seeks qualified instructors to fill part-time positions teaching American Sign Language courses.

These are in-person positions, and classes will be taught on the Johnson City, Tennessee main campus.

Located in the Appalachian Highlands of Northeast Tennessee between the Great Smoky Mountains and the Blue Ridge Mountains, East Tennessee State University is a state-assisted and Carnegie-classified Doctoral Research Intensive University of more than 15,000 students.

The Department of Literature and Language is a large, vibrant, and diverse department made up of English, World Languages, Film and Media Studies, Creative Writing, and other related disciplines.

These are temporary, adjunct positions, filled on a semester-by-semester basis with some opportunity for renewal.

Adjunct faculty positions do not include benefits.

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ities The successful candidate will be qualified to teach courses in American Sign Language and/or Deaf Culture.

Experience teaching American Sign Language in a post-secondary setting.

Required Qualifications The ideal candidate will have a Master's degree in ASL, ASL Instruction, Deaf Culture/Education, or a closely-related field.

Candidates with at least 18 graduate credit hours in a relevant field will also be considered.

Equivalent combinations of education and directly related professional experience may also be considered.
